Axxius® 800 Access Integration Platform
 
Download Video (39Mb)
Highlights:
Provides a cost-effective, multi-function platform optimized for cell site access, traffic aggregation, and backhaul
Integrates 3/1/0 cross-connecting/grooming, access multiplexing, and Ethernet switching/routing functionality
Delivers industry-leading port density - up to 36 T1 capacity - in a compact, 2RU enclosure
Enables remote management and LAN connectivity to all cell site equipment
Provides a modular, temperature-hardened design that supports full redundancy
Deploys ideally, in GSM, BSS, and UMTS overlay network applications
Overview
The Axxius 800 Access Integration Platform defines a new level of functionality, cost-effectiveness, and performance for access needs at cell sites. The Axxius 800 integrates multiple access and bandwidth management functions into one modular platform that delivers transport and bandwidth 3/1/0 grooming intelligence to network access points. This eliminates bandwidth underutilization, and costly inefficiencies, between central offices (COs) or wireless cell site radios, periphery equipment, and the high-speed carrier edge and core networks.
Consolidated Functionality and Performance for Cell Site Access
Highly versatile and scalable, the Axxius 800 is a key component of Turin's iConnect™ solution for wireless backhaul, which enables cost-effective multi-generation service integration and evolution (2G/2.5G, 3G, and 4G).

The Axxius 800 platform's two-rack unit design can support up to eight hot-swappable service cards, providing a scalable mix of interfaces to meet the complex network challenges of today and those of the future. The QuadFLEX™ DS1/E1 Service Card for the Axxius 800 provides improved backhaul transport optimization, statistical multiplexing, and inter-working functions that consolidates 2/2.5G, location-based services, remote management, and future 3G Node B equipment over a truly optimized backhaul transport.
